Kettle Moraine Land Trust (KMLT) seeks a seasonal intern for land management and basic ecologic restoration to implement KMLT’s land stewardship activities. The position also will participate in outreach programs and activities. This is a part-time, seasonal position.
This is a summer seasonal position funded for 200 hours (10-12 weeks or as arranged). Part-time 15-20 hours/week. $12-18/hr DOE, without benefits.
Primary Duties and Responsibilities:
- Stewardship: Under the direction of KMLT staff, the intern will implement land management and maintenance activities in KMLT nature preserves and partner sites. Activities may include implementing control of non-native/invasive species and other ecological restoration, maintaining trails for the visiting public, collaborating with volunteers on stewardship workdays, maintaining tools/equipment, and participating in monitoring activities.
Additional Duties and Responsibilities
- Education and Outreach: Assist with outreach activities and programs. Activities may include participating in youth-oriented education programs, assisting with volunteer activities, and promoting activities within the community to increase awareness of and support for KMLT.
- General Administration: Assist in maintaining and updating files and records of preserves and easements. Complete other duties as assigned by staff and site stewards.
